^ Yeah, I meant Intamin. They were representing Schwarzkopf as a company. Zierer and BHS only stepped in after Herr Schwarzkopf's company closed its doors and did also build the coasters. That's why the likes of Olympia Looping and Lisebergbanan aren't technically products of Schwarzkopf company, but rather of Zierer/BHS, with Schwarzkopf 'only' as a designer of the ride.
